À propos de ce contenu audio

This day-by-day, factual, and complete account of events throughout the coronavirus pandemic, written as it happened, gives incredible insight into what life was like during this tragic and historic pandemic in the United Kingdom and worldwide. It includes facts and figures, government initiatives, news events, moving individual accounts, and the horrific consequences, as they happened each day. There is also a daily personal slant on what life was like for the author and his family during what threatened to be an apocalyptic event.

Not including the preamble, the diary covers 491 days, beginning in earnest on March 16, 2020, until Freedom Day on July 19, 2021. It has over half a million words with every significant event covered, and some strange and bizarre facts you were probably unaware of.

Part two covers the second wave and vaccine development: October 4, 2020, to February 2, 2021.
